ISBN: 0764317547 ISBN-13: 9780764317545 Publisher: Schiffer Publishing OUR PRICE: $40.46 Product Type: Hardcover Published: February 2003 Annotation: Inspiration for any would-be homebuilder or interior designer who wants to incorporate ancestral folk architecture in a modern home. Tour more than 35 houses, inside and out, through beautiful color photographs. Most are shown with floor plans to help visualize the tour, and to aid home builders in planning their custom dwelling. There are great ideas for kitchens, great rooms, dens, dining areas, sunrooms, bedrooms, and porches. This is a wonderful resource for anyone trying to decide between timber-frame or log home construction, or a combination of both. |
